Atlanta Apparel Releases Children’s Fall/Winter 2022 Lookbook

March 22, 2022 by Publisher

little girl fashionsby International Market Centers

In early March, the Atlanta Apparel in-house fashion office released its Fall/Winter 2022 Children’s Lookbook, previewing some of the top themes, prints, key items, and colors for next season. 

Popular Colors & Patterns

“Children’s apparel trends reflect an emphasis on the great outdoors, cottage, craft, comfort, and sustainability,” Morgan Ramage, Atlanta Apparel Fashion Director, said. “The impact of the pandemic shifted the focus to nature and the trending prints and colors that reflect those motifs.”

The key colors coming up in Children’s for Fall/Winter are: Beetroot – shades of purple and soft pinks which represent the cottage and comfort themes, and Algae Green, Jade Green, and Rich Brown reflecting the emphasis on nature and sustainability. 

Following this same color story, Patterns for Fall/Winter in children’s apparel will help to visually express the major themes, especially the great outdoors, which include star motifs, animal motifs, hiking, camping and mountain prints, and food and fruit patterns. Children’s must-have apparel items coming for next season emphasize warmth and comfort, with soft basics, which include t-shirts and pants, quilted jackets, knitwear, smocked craft dresses, ribbed leggings, overalls, hair accessories, puffer suits, and mary jane shoes.

Growing in the fashion industry as a whole, “mommy & me” styles also are a focus of the next season and are pictured throughout the Lookbook in various styles. The matching outfits for mothers and their children picked up momentum at Atlanta Apparel’s February edition and is projected to make a booming return at Atlanta Apparel’s upcoming children’s markets. April will close up the Fall/Winter 2022/2023 and Spring/Summer 2023 will launch in August on the floor with both permanent showrooms and temporaries featuring the new season.

“The Fall/Winter 2022 Lookbook provides a preview of these trends in a way that makes it easy for buyers and brands to understand,” Ramage added. “The Lookbook, which was first published as an at-market tool in February, is available digitally on the website for reference between markets as well as leading into next season.” The Children’s Fall/Winter 2022 Lookbook is available here.

The trends are brought to life with images supplied by brands featured during the February 2022 Atlanta Apparel Market. Children’s apparel showrooms at AmericasMart Atlanta are open during four of the five yearly Atlanta Apparel markets (February, April, August, and October), with children’s temporary exhibits presented semi-annually in February and August. Pre-registration for April Atlanta Apparel is open now at Atlanta-Apparel.com. Children’s showrooms will also be open during the AmericasMart Spring Market, March 2-4, and the July Atlanta Market giving buyers the opportunity to shop an expanded collection of children’s apparel and accessories.

IMC’s five Atlanta Apparel markets feature the latest looks in contemporary, young contemporary, women’s modern, shoes, fashion accessories, and more, plus specialty categories such as children’s and plus-size.
